a e@charset "utf-8";
table {border-collapse : collapse;}
table td, table th {padding : 0px;}
* {	padding:0px; margin:0px;}
body { margin:0px auto;font-family:Arial; font-size:12px; color:#333; line-height:150%;}
li { list-style:none;}
#box{margin:0 auto; width:1200px;
background:#FFFFFF;}
#banner{
background:url(../../Content/Admim_img/banner.png) top left no-repeat;
width:100%;
height:66px;
}
#tab{
margin:1px;
width:1200px;
}
#tab_l{
border:1px solid #CCCCCC;
float:left;
width:100%;
}
.menu{
background:url(../../Content/Admim_img/menu.png) top left repeat-x;
margin:1px;
font-size:16px;
padding-left:5px;
}
.list
{
    width:300px;
margin:2px;
border:1px solid #CCCCCC;
min-height:600px; overflow:hidden;
}
.list li a{
text-decoration:none;
}
.list li a:hover{
color: #DFEFFF;
}

#tab_r{border:1px solid  #CCCCCC;
float:right;
width:100%;
}
.listview{
background:url(../../Content/Admim_img/menu.png) top left repeat-x;
margin:1px;
font-size:16px;
padding-left:5px;
}
.thucdon{
margin:2px;
border:1px solid #CCCCCC;
min-height:600px;
}
.thucdon li {

display:inline;
}
.thucdon li a{
text-decoration:none;}


.AjaxLoad
{
    position:absolute;
    height:2px;
    visibility:hidden;
}
.banner_menu
{
    float:right;
    text-align:right;
    padding-top:30px;
}
.FeedBack {
	BORDER-RIGHT: #999999 1px solid;
	BORDER-TOP: #999999  1px solid;
	FONT-WEIGHT: normal;
	FONT-SIZE: 12px;
	BORDER-LEFT: #999999 1px solid;
	COLOR: #333333; BORDER-BOTTOM: #999999  1px solid;
	FONT-FAMILY: Arial;
	COLOR: black;
	margin: 2px 0pt 2px;

}
.FeedBack2 {
	BORDER-RIGHT: #999999 1px solid;
	BORDER-TOP: #999999  1px solid;
	FONT-WEIGHT: bold;
	FONT-SIZE: 8pt;
	BORDER-LEFT: #999999 1px solid;
	COLOR: #333333; BORDER-BOTTOM: #999999  1px solid;
	FONT-FAMILY: Verdana, Arial, Helvetica;
	COLOR: black;
	margin: 2px 0pt 2px;
	
}
.ItemDataGrid td	{border-width:0px;	border-bottom:1px solid #DFEFFF; color:#039; text-align:left}
.HeaderDataGrid td	{text-align:left; border-width:0px; border-bottom:2px solid #d6d6d6;}
.HeaderDataGrid		{color:#f04f2d;	font-weight:bold; height:20px;}
.detailsCate
{
	font-family: Tahoma, Arial;
	font-size: 11px;
	font-weight: normal;
	color: black;
	background-color: #ffffff;
	border-bottom:dashed 1px #999999;
}
a:link
{
    color:Black;
    text-decoration: none;
    font-weight:normal;
}
a:visited
{
    color:Black;
    text-decoration: none;
    font-weight:boldf;
    
}
a:hover
{
    color:Blue;
    text-decoration: none;
    font-weight:bold;
}
a:active
{
    color: #Blue;
}
.CityID
{
    width:50px;
}
.field-validation-error
{
    color: #ff0000;
}
.TextAreaArticle TextArea{ width:700px; height:100px; margin-top:10px; margin-bottom:10px;}
.displayhiden{ display:none}
.field-validation-error
{
    color: #ff0000;
}
.field-validation-error2
{
    color: #ff0000;
}
.field-validation-errorHidden
{
    display:none;
}
#IDetails a
{
    font-weight:normal;
}
.cartHeaders{width:650px; height:24px; color:#ff0000; background:#ccc; float:left; border-bottom:1px solid #eee}
.itemName{width:300px; float:left}
.itemPrice{width:100px; float:left}
.itemQuantity{width:80px; float:left}
.itemTotal{width:120px; float:left}
.item_remove{width:50px; float:left}
.itemContainer{width:650px; line-height:140%; background:#eee; float:left}